Output 768d6f7ac79d17b3a7162bbcb94640a2aabdb4d7efdc8ee4a87bc1e97893795f:2

value
3510686
script pubkey
OP_0 OP_PUSHBYTES_20 fa691a4e84826b1ba36368bcd7f9f1a783a03ba2
address
ltc1qlf535n5ysf43hgmrdz7d070357p6qwaz9v3xef
transaction
768d6f7ac79d17b3a7162bbcb94640a2aabdb4d7efdc8ee4a87bc1e97893795f
spent
true